Identification of Color-coded Resistor


Resistors with color bands are a convenient way for users to determine their resistance value simply by identifying the colored bands, without the need for any measuring tools. This type of marking is commonly found on cylindrical resistors such as carbon film, metal film, metal oxide film, fuse, and wire-wound resistors. These components typically have four, five, or six color bands that represent their resistance value and other specifications.

Color-coded resistors are among the most frequently used electronic components in circuits. They feature colored bands painted on their surface to indicate their resistance value. The units commonly used include ohms (Ω), kilo-ohms (KΩ), and mega-ohms (MΩ). For reference, 1 MΩ equals 1,000 KΩ or 1,000,000 Ω.

Most color-coded resistors come in either four-band or five-band configurations, with the four-band version being more common. In a four-band resistor, the first two bands represent the significant digits, the third band indicates the multiplier, and the fourth band shows the tolerance. For five-band resistors, the first three bands are the significant digits, the fourth is the multiplier, and the fifth is the tolerance. Tolerance is usually indicated by gold (5%), silver (10%), or brown (1%). A missing band means a 20% tolerance, while green occasionally represents a 0.5% tolerance.

Identifying Four-Band Resistors

A four-band resistor uses four colored bands to show its resistance value. Starting from the left, the first band is the first digit, the second is the second digit, the third is the multiplier, and the fourth is the tolerance. If you're unsure which band is the first one, look for the fourth band, which is often gold or silver, as it's rarely another color. This method only applies to four-band resistors.

Examples:

  • Red, Yellow, Brown, Gold: 24 × 10 = 240 Ω, Tolerance: 5%
  • Green, Red, Yellow, Silver: 52 × 10,000 = 520 KΩ, Tolerance: 10%

Identifying Five-Band Resistors

Five-band resistors use five colored bands to represent their resistance value. From left to right, the first three bands are the significant digits, the fourth is the multiplier, and the fifth is the tolerance. For example, Red, Red, Black, Black, Brown would be interpreted as 220 × 1 = 220 Ω, with a 1% tolerance.

Identifying Six-Band Resistors

Six-band resistors are less common and are used in precision applications. The first five bands follow the same pattern as a five-band resistor, but the sixth band indicates the temperature coefficient. These resistors are typically found in high-precision electronic systems where stability over temperature is critical.
